对象存储原理详细解释,深入解析对象存储原理,技术架构与工作流程详解
- 综合资讯
- 2024-12-19 02:37:04
- 1

对象存储原理涉及将数据存储为独立对象,每个对象包含数据本身、元数据和唯一标识符。技术架构包括存储节点、网络和客户端。工作流程包括对象上传、存储、检索和删除。深入解析其原...
对象存储原理涉及将数据存储为独立对象,每个对象包含数据本身、元数据和唯一标识符。技术架构包括存储节点、网络和客户端。工作流程包括对象上传、存储、检索和删除。深入解析其原理和技术细节,有助于理解对象存储的高效与可靠性。
随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的存储方式已经无法满足日益增长的数据存储需求,对象存储作为一种新型存储技术,因其高效、安全、可扩展的特点,逐渐成为各大企业、机构的首选存储方案,本文将深入解析对象存储原理,从技术架构、工作流程等方面进行全面剖析。
对象存储技术架构
对象存储技术架构主要由以下几个部分组成:
1、存储节点(Storage Node):存储节点是对象存储系统的基本单元,负责存储数据,每个存储节点包含一个或多个硬盘,存储数据时将数据分割成多个块,并存储在不同的硬盘上,以保证数据的可靠性和安全性。
2、元数据服务器(Metadata Server):元数据服务器负责管理存储节点的元数据信息,包括数据块的存储位置、数据块的属性、数据块的访问权限等,元数据服务器是对象存储系统的核心,负责处理用户请求,并将请求转发给相应的存储节点。
3、数据传输网络(Data Transmission Network):数据传输网络负责连接存储节点和元数据服务器,实现数据块的传输,数据传输网络通常采用高速、可靠的网络设备,以保证数据传输的稳定性和安全性。
4、访问控制服务器(Access Control Server):访问控制服务器负责管理用户权限,确保只有授权用户才能访问存储在对象存储系统中的数据。
5、数据备份与恢复系统:数据备份与恢复系统负责对存储在对象存储系统中的数据进行备份,并在数据丢失或损坏时进行恢复。
对象存储工作流程
1、用户请求:用户通过客户端向对象存储系统发送请求,请求存储或访问数据。
2、权限验证:访问控制服务器验证用户权限,确保用户有权访问或存储数据。
3、元数据管理:元数据服务器根据用户请求,查找存储节点,并将数据块的存储位置、属性等信息存储在元数据数据库中。
4、数据传输:数据传输网络将数据块传输到指定的存储节点。
5、数据存储:存储节点将数据块存储在硬盘上,并根据元数据信息进行管理。
6、数据访问:当用户请求访问数据时,元数据服务器根据用户权限和请求信息,查找数据块的存储位置,并将数据块传输给用户。
7、数据备份与恢复:数据备份与恢复系统定期对数据进行备份,并在数据丢失或损坏时进行恢复。
对象存储优势
1、高效:对象存储系统采用分布式存储架构,可以充分利用存储资源,提高数据存储效率。
2、安全:对象存储系统支持数据加密、访问控制等功能,确保数据的安全性和可靠性。
3、可扩展:对象存储系统可以根据需求进行横向扩展,满足不断增长的数据存储需求。
4、良好的兼容性:对象存储系统支持多种协议,如HTTP、HTTPS、WebDAV等,方便用户进行数据访问和管理。
5、低成本:对象存储系统采用通用硬件,降低存储成本。
对象存储技术作为一种高效、安全、可扩展的存储方式,在数据存储领域具有广阔的应用前景,随着技术的不断发展,对象存储技术将在未来发挥更加重要的作用。
本文链接:https://www.zhitaoyun.cn/1654831.html
发表评论